To be clear guys: It's not that iOS supports Flash literally (unless you jailbreak it and install that experimental Flash hack). It's that the Adobe-provided Flash development program allows you to have your Flash code compiled in a way that will run on the iOS.
If I'm understanding things correctly. (Anyone can correct me if I'm wrong.) |

What Flash CS5 and Adobe labs Panini and Burrito are doing is basically wrapping ActionScript 3 with an ObjectiveC wrapper that allows it to run. If you want the correct terms, whatnot, read this. |
